Chambre meublée lumineuse à louer dans le quartier calme d'IJburg, Amsterdam

Cette chambre meublée est située sur Nico Jessekade dans le quartier d'IJburg à Amsterdam. La chambre mesure environ 5 x 3,5 mètres (17 m²) et est particulièrement adaptée aux étudiants, notamment ceux étudiant la musique ou les arts, car elle est décrite comme un espace idéal pour les répétitions privées en raison du faible niveau sonore dans la zone. L'espace est lumineux et calme, offrant un environnement confortable pour étudier et vivre. La chambre fait partie d'un foyer partagé avec le propriétaire, un homme de 64 ans, et une locataire de 36 ans. Les locataires partagent une salle de bain et des toilettes avec les autres occupants. De petites installations de cuisine privées sont disponibles dans la chambre, y compris une plaque à induction et un réfrigérateur. Internet est disponible et la propriété dispose d'un label énergétique A2, indiquant une bonne efficacité énergétique. Le loyer de base est de 650 € par mois, hors charges. Des frais supplémentaires de 130 € par mois couvrent des services tels que le chauffage, l'électricité et l'internet par fibre optique. Le propriétaire précise qu'il recherche un profil de locataire idéal correspondant à un étudiant salarié âgé de 25 à 35 ans. La durée de location privilégiée est d'un an, et la maîtrise du néerlandais, de l'anglais ou de l'allemand est souhaitable. Les animaux de compagnie ne sont pas autorisés et le foyer comprend des colocataires mixtes. Le quartier d'IJburg offre un cadre résidentiel calme tout en maintenant une forte connectivité avec le centre d'Amsterdam. Les transports en commun permettent d'accéder à la gare centrale en environ 20 minutes, rendant l'emplacement pratique pour les engagements académiques et professionnels dans la ville. La zone combine le calme de la vie en banlieue avec l'accessibilité des équipements urbains.
